STRATFORD Council may have to find thousands of pounds to defend itself after turning down a planning application in Haselor.

The owner of Lower Barn Farm applied to change the use of redundant buildings for storage and distribution but the council said this would be detrimental to the area.

It also ruled the size and number of heavy goods vehicles likely to be used would be out of character with the tranquil setting of the area and turned down the application.

But the owner, Mr Gray-Cheape, appealed against the decision and an inquiry was held in May.
